Very nice spot for a nice meal. The place itself has a great atmosphere, just a tad upscale but not anywhere near snobby. The food is good quality, although sometimes a bit expensive. I got to try the fried smelts and the It’s Green burger.
Both were really good. It’s rare to find fried smelts anywhere in the area (last time I had them was in Spain). But here, they do a very nice job of making them. A good amount of lemon provided, relatively crispy battering, and fresh fish that doesn’t taste too fishy. They also had a pretty flavorful sauce with it (possibly tartar but I’m not sure).
The burger was also great. They cooked it perfectly for my liking. The green sauce wasn’t too spicy and overall the burger just tasted balanced. The fires it was served with were also wonderful: quite crispy and salty.
All in all, well done to this place. It’s a nice atmosphere and they serve great food. Would recommend.
